Table Of ContentCalculus Topic: Review of Basics 1. Numbers and Their Disguises Brackets, multiplying and dividing fractions, adding and subtracting fractions, exponents, roots, percent, scientific notation, calculators, rounding, intervals Calculus Topic: Circles, Parabolas, etc. 2. Completing the Square Completing the square in one and two variables Calculus Topic: Equations 3. Solving Equations Equations of degree 1 and 2, solving other types of equations, rational equations, the zero-factor property Calculus Topic: Functions and Graphs 4. Functions and Their Graphs Introduction, equations of lines, power functions, shifting graphs, intersection of curves Calculus Topic: Limits 5. Changing the Form of a Function Factoring, canceling, long division, rationalizing, extracting a factor from under a radical Calculus Topic: Derivatives 6. Simplifying Algebraic Expressions Working with difference quotients and rational functions, canceling common factors, rationalizing expressions Calculus Topic: Derivatives of Trigonometric Functions 7. Cyclic Phenomena: The Six Basic Trigonometric Functions Angles, definitions of the six trigonometric functions, special angles, graphs involving sin x and cos x , graphs of complex trigonometric functions Calculus Topic: The Chain Rule 8. Composition and Decomposition of Functions Composite functions, inner, outer, and outermost functions, decomposing composite functions Calculus Topic: Implicit Differentiation 9. Equations of Degree 1 Revisited Solving linear equations involving derivatives Calculus Topic: Related Rates, Applied Max-Min Problems 10. Word Problems Algebraic word problems; the geometry of rectangles, circles and spheres, trigonometric word problems, right angle triangles, the law of sines and the law of cosines Calculus Topic: Integrating Trigonometric Functions 11. Trigonometric Identities Rewriting trigonometric expressions using identities Appendices A. Exponential Functions B. Inverse Functions C. Logarithmic Functions D. Inverse Trigonometric Functions E. The Binomial Theorem E. Derivation of the Quadratic Formula Answers to Exercises Index

Use this book as your study companion and put your anxiety to rest KEY TOPICS: Numbers and Their Disguises; Completing the Square; Solving Equations; Functions and Their Graphs; Changing the Form of a Function; Simplifying Algebraic Expressions; Cyclic Phenomena: The Six Basic Trigonometric Functions; Composition and Decomposition of Functions; Equations of Degree 1 Revisited; Word Problems; Trigonometric Identities MARKET: For all readers interested in strengthening their algebra and trigonometry skills for studying calculus., This book is designed for current calculus students to review the algebra and trigonometry skills that are so crucial for success in calculus. Organized to correspond to a typical calculus course, relevant algebra and trigonometry topics are presented just as students need them, with warnings about pitfalls and exercise sets for practice. Whether used as a reference or for catching up, this text will prove invaluable for all students taking calculus. Note: a different version of this book is available specifically for Early Transcendentals calculus courses., Are you ready to ace calculus at the college level? With this book, you will be!
